'It Was Everybody, Together'
David Auspitz
David Auspitz of Philadelphia was just 17 years old when he heard that a march was being scheduled in Washington, DC. He and a friend drove down to DC to attend. He recalled his observation when he arrived at the nations capital, "It was not a sea of black faces. It was not a sea of white faces with a sprinkling of African Americans in the support. It was everybody together." Auspitz also reflects on the impact of that event, and its legacy.
